Jiva Unveils Sustainable Power Unit with Nexperia, Ligna Energy + Epishine
(Photograph: Jiva)
As Electronica 2024 in Munich earlier this month, Jiva was incredibly proud to unveil the Sustainable Power Unit, a cutting-edge solution that harnesses ambient energy to power low-energy electronics.
By integrating groundbreaking technologies from industry leaders including Nexperia, Ligna Energy and Epishine, the project marked a significant leap forward in reducing the environmental impact of electronics.
At the heart of the Sustainable Power Unit is energy harvesting technology, powered by Nexperia’s NEH2000BY Power Management IC, which collects ambient energy, such as light, and stores it in a bio-based supercapacitor from Ligna Energy.
This sustainable supercapacitor is made from bio-organic materials, free from toxic chemicals and metals such as lithium. The unit powers a humidity and temperature sensor that transmits data via Bluetooth, all while eliminating the need for traditional batteries.
The Sustainable Power Unit is fully recyclable, with Jiva’s Soluboard® PCB serving as the base of the unit. Soluboard® is the world’s first fully recyclable printed circuit board substrate, offering a 67% reduction in carbon footprint compared to conventional PCBs.
Key Features and Benefits:
- Powered by Nexperia’s NEH2000BY IC, it collects energy from ambient light sources, reducing the need for battery replacements
- Epishine’s organic solar cells efficiently harvest low-energy ambient light for power
- Ligna’s S-Power 2S supercapacitor, made of bio-organic materials, eliminates toxic chemicals and metals
- Jiva’s Soluboard® PCB, made from fully recyclable material, lowers carbon emissions by 67% compared to standard PCBs
- Bluetooth-enabled temperature and humidity sensors send data to mobile devices or communication nodes
Target Applications:
- Ideal for sensors and devices requiring minimal power, such as IoT applications
- The compact design of the NEH2000BY IC, Ligna’s supercapacitor, Epishine’s thin organic solar cells and Jiva’s reduced density substrate make it suitable for space or mass-limited applications
- Perfect for Proptech, asset tracking, and food safety control applications, where sustainability and efficiency are critical
